GENERAL ABSTRACT SILVA, Daiani Maria. Identification of species of Aspergillus Nigri Section by polyphasic taxonomy and description of two new species of the genus. 2009. 76 p. Dissertation (Master of Science in Agricultural Microbiology) â Federal University of Lavras, Lavras, MG, Brazil. Aspergillus stands for a genus of great economic importance for being utilized in industrial processes and for being responsible for the deterioration of foods as well as the production of mycotoxins. The identification of most of the species of the genus Aspergillus has been troublesome due to the variability of the phenotypic characteristics. Recently, Polyphasic Taxonomy has been used in the identification and classification of the species belonging to the genus, especially in the description of new species. The objective o this study were to promote the Identification of species of the Nigri Section, which possesses one of the most complex and confuses of the genus and the Description of an isolate of the Flavi Section utilizing Polyphasic Taxonomy. The isolates were studied by using morphologic and physiologic data, images generated from scanning electronic microscopy and molecular data with the sequencing of Ã-tubulin gene. The results showed that Polyphasic Taxonomy is efficient in species identification. A new species from the Nigri Section is being proposed, named Aspergillus sp, based mainly upon by its morphological characteristics. A new species A. gruticola, belonging to the Flavi Section was also distinguished through the morphology, physiology and sequencing of Ã-tubulin gene. This study shows that Polyphasic Taxonomy is a safe method for the identification and differentiation of species of the genus Aspergillus.
